Are you able to write descriptions with haughty looks, slight to moderate sneers, and general disdain?

If so, then I’d say you’ve got this.

It’s important to keep in mind that elegance and snobbishness are two different things. They can, of course, exist together as they often do; but you can also absolutely have one without the other. To be a snob, just have your character treat others as if she is superior. It might help to keep this behavior slightly subtle to avoid coming across as simply hateful and aggressive if you take it too far. That subtlety will also help you with the elegance angle, since someone who carries herself with refined grace would likely not allow a total breakdown of character during most interactions.

Now if it’s eloquence you’re talking about, that might be a little harder to pull off with a limited vocabulary, especially since it’s defined by having a certain mastery of words and expressing thoughts.

Being english as a second language can be tough when seeking this kind of character, but not impossible! Here’s some ideas for striking the right flavor and feel.

https://www.thesaurus.com/ can be a huge friend! Write up some words you love or use alot. Then look them up for other words and options. Write them down, and toss them into your emotes and speaking.

Look up book and movie quotes. https://www.goodreads.com/ has a ton of great quotes folks save from books. This can give you ideas for how to write flowery or haughty.

Period and historic movies and tv shows are fantastic for elevated language and seeing the emotion of the actors. Downton Abbey, Bridgerton, The Crown, and so on are great examples.

I am new to RP, new to the server and speak English as a second language, so I can relate. Here is a possible path for those finding language barriers:

Look for a guild or a group of RPers that is/are predominantly of a race that is not the same race as your character. If you play [A], a dwarf in a human guild, o a human in a night elf guild. Playing [H], a blood elf in an Orc guild, you get the idea.

Implement the language barrier as part of your RP. Look in advance some keywords and make the lack of knowledge of YOUR language a weakness on their side. With proper dosage, that can range from being elegant, slightly arrogant all the way to completely derogatory and evil.

Open a notepad, word doc or any other app of your taste and start collecting phrases from others that make sense to you. Study their grammar. Get inspired by them mixing and matching statements with expressions. No need to copy and paste, go for the grammar structure but change the verbs and adapt.

A few of the things I do when I go for more elegant characters. When they gesture with their hands I tend to point out their their hands are delicate, soft, and well manicured. I also like to point out how well kept their hair is or how beautiful and clean their clothes look. As far as speech patterns, I go for proper and well spoken, sometimes using unusual word choices for them to highlight they are better educated. Since you want snobbish, make them critical and picky about things like wine and food. When they meet people, have them size them up based on how they look, act, and speak. Have them make comments that could be insults disguised as compliments. For example “Oh you’re wearing that? I see.” And maybe have them wrinkle their nose or poorly disguise a laugh. As far as English not being your mother tongue, give yourself time to practice with rp and it will get easier. I rp with a few people from other countries and that is what they’ve told me.
